Call of Duty: Black Ops 6's upcoming Season 2 update brings exciting news for Zombies fans, revealed in a recent Season 2 teaser. Over a decade after its debut in World at War, Zombies remains a cornerstone of Call of Duty, and Black Ops 6 is no exception. Treyarch continues to expand upon the round-based Zombies experience, developing immersive new locations and implementing player-requested improvements.
While Season 2 delivers substantial multiplayer updates, Zombies receives significant attention as well. Beyond the new Tomb map, players will enjoy a range of features enhancing gameplay. A highly requested co-op pause option allows players in the same party to pause the game collaboratively, a welcome addition since pausing and saving were introduced in Black Ops 6.
Call of Duty Reveals Black Ops 6 Zombies Changes for Season 2
- Challenge Tracking & Near Completion (Zombies and Multiplayer): Manually track up to 10 Calling Card and 10 Camo Challenges per mode. If fewer than 10 are tracked, the closest-to-completion challenges will automatically display. Top tracked or near-completion challenges appear in the lobby and in-game options menu.
- Co-op Pause: The party leader can pause the game for all party members.
- AFK Kick Loadout Recovery: Players kicked for inactivity can rejoin with their original loadout.
- Separate HUD Presets for Zombies and Multiplayer: Customize HUD settings independently for each mode.
Alongside the co-op pause, AFK Kick Loadout Recovery prevents the loss of progress for players unexpectedly removed from matches. Losing weapons, perks, and points can significantly hinder a Zombies run; this feature mitigates that frustration.
The ability to create separate HUD presets for multiplayer and Zombies eliminates the need to constantly adjust settings between modes. Finally, the improved challenge tracking system simplifies progress through the extensive Calling Card and Camo collections. Season 2 of Call of Duty: Black Ops 6 launches January 28, 2025.
